    Not sure on seating from 2nd gen to 2.5 gen. But most of the seats are the same sizes and should be able to swap out if wanting to. 07-13 should all be same size and interchangeable. Same with 14-21. Front seats are captain chairs or bench seating. Not sure on the bench seating for front as mine are the captain chairs. Back is 60/40 split. I removed mine and put in a platform for my dogs. I did it 60/40 so I can put a seat section back in if needed. Very easy to remove and add. 47624.jpg 20200809_121345.jpg

    The difference will be 1 foot. Same frame. Difference from DC and CM is DC has 1 foot less cab space, 1 foot more bed space.
